Social Media Marketing Agency vs. Social Media Management: What's the
Difference?
The
terms get used interchangeably, but they cover different scopes of work. A social
media marketing agency in Dubai typically owns strategy, paid campaigns,
content production, and platform selection - the full growth engine. Social
media management, by contrast, often refers to the day-to-day execution:
posting schedules, community replies, and monitoring. Many Dubai businesses
need both, which is why the strongest social media agencies in Dubai fold
management into the broader marketing agency service rather than treating it as
a separate, cheaper add-on.

What a Real Social Media Marketing Agency in Dubai Actually Delivers
- Platform strategy - choosing where to invest based on where the audience actually is, not posting everywhere by default
- Content production - graphics, reels, and copy built around a consistent brand voice
- Paid social campaigns - targeted ad spend on Meta, LinkedIn, and TikTok tied to specific conversion goals
- Community management - responding to comments, messages, and reviews in a timely, on-brand way
- Reporting - clear monthly numbers on reach, engagement, and conversions, not vanity metrics alone
Platform-by-Platform: Where Dubai Brands Should Focus
- Instagram - still the default for retail, F&B, beauty, and lifestyle brands targeting UAE consumers
- LinkedIn - essential for B2B, professional services, and recruitment-driven social media marketing
- TikTok - fastest-growing channel for reaching younger, high-engagement UAE audiences
- Snapchat - still relevant for specific demographics and daily-deal style promotions in the region
How to Evaluate a Social Media Agency in Dubai Before You Sign
- Ask to see actual client results, not just design mockups
- Check whether reporting includes conversions and leads, not just likes and follower counts
- Confirm who creates the content - an in-house team or unnamed freelancers
- Ask how they've handled a client's social media management during a slow month or a negative review cycle
Signs Your Current Social Media Management Isn't Working
- Posting happens on a schedule with no clear tie to business goals
- Engagement is flat month over month with no strategy adjustments
- You don't know what "success" looks like in your monthly report
- Paid social spend exists but no one can explain the targeting logic behind it
